Transforming an Improper to Mixed Fraction
bc=QRcwhere Q is the quotient of (b÷c) and R is the remainderA Mixed Number or Mixed Fraction consists of a whole number and a fraction.First, divide the numerator by the denominatorArrange the numbers for long division4 goes into 25 six times. So write 6 above the line.Multiply 6 to 4 and write the answer below 25Subtract 24 from 25 and write the answer one line belowSince 4 cannot go into 1 anymore, 1 is left as the Remainder and 6 is the QuotientSubstitute values into the given formulabc = QRc 254 = 614 614 -
